首页 > 科技 >

vlookup函数的使用方法图解

发布时间:2025-02-09 20:47:59来源:

VLOOKUP 函数是 Excel 中非常实用的一个工具,用于在一个数据表中查找某个值,并返回与之相关联的数据。为了帮助您更好地理解 VLOOKUP 的使用方法,我将通过文字描述和示例来解释其基本用法。

VLOOKUP 函数的基本结构

VLOOKUP 函数的基本语法如下:

```

VLOOKUP(lookup_value, table_array, col_index_num, [range_lookup])

```

- `lookup_value`:您希望在表格的第一列中查找的值。

- `table_array`:包含数据的表格区域。

- `col_index_num`:从 `table_array` 返回的列号。

- `[range_lookup]`:可选参数,指定是否进行近似匹配(TRUE 或 1)或精确匹配(FALSE 或 0)。

示例说明

假设我们有一个员工工资表,数据如下:

| 员工编号 | 姓名 | 部门 | 工资 |

|----------|--------|--------|------|

| 001| 张三 | 技术部 | 8000 |

| 002| 李四 | 销售部 | 9000 |

| 003| 王五 | 人事部 | 7000 |

使用 VLOOKUP 查找员工姓名

如果我们想根据员工编号(例如 002)找到对应的姓名,可以使用以下公式:

```excel

=VLOOKUP("002", A2:D4, 2, FALSE)

```

这里:

- `"002"` 是我们想要查找的 `lookup_value`。

- `A2:D4` 是我们的 `table_array`,即整个表格区域。

- `2` 表示我们要返回 `table_array` 中第二列的数据(即姓名)。

- `FALSE` 表示我们要求进行精确匹配。

结果

上述公式的计算结果将是“李四”。

注意事项

- `table_array` 的第一列必须包含 `lookup_value`。

- 如果没有找到匹配项且 `range_lookup` 设置为 `FALSE`,VLOOKUP 将返回错误 N/A。

- 如果 `range_lookup` 设置为 `TRUE` 或省略,则需要确保 `table_array` 的第一列按升序排序,否则可能返回不正确的结果。

希望以上内容能帮助您理解并正确使用 VLOOKUP 函数。如果您需要更详细的图解教程,建议查阅相关的在线资源或视频教程,这些通常会提供直观的图表和步骤演示。

免责声明:本文为转载,非本网原创内容,不代表本网观点。其原创性以及文中陈述文字和内容未经本站证实,对本文以及其中全部或者部分内容、文字的真实性、完整性、及时性本站不作任何保证或承诺,请读者仅作参考,并请自行核实相关内容。